Applesauce Muffins
TOTAL TIME: Prep: 10 min. Bake:  about 30 min.
Ingredients
- 1 cup butter, softened
 - 2 cups sugar
 - 2 eggs
 - 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
 - 2 cups applesauce
 - 4 cups all-purpose flour
 - 1 teaspoon baking soda
 - 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
 - 1 teaspoon ground allspice
 - 1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
 - 1 cup chopped walnuts, optional (YES use these!)
 - Cinnamon-sugar, optional
 - Directions
 
- 1. In a b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add eggs and vanilla; mix well. Stir in applesauce. Combine the flour, baking soda and spices; stir into creamed mixture. Fold in nuts.
 - 2. Fill greased or paper-lined muffin cups three-fourths full. Bake at 350° for 30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ool for 5 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ks. Sprinkle with cinnamon-sugar if desired. Yield: about 2 dozen.
